Liverpool, Merseyside, UK 6th December, 2015. The Medicash Santa Dash course starts and finishes in Liverpool city centre with a 5K route beginning at the Santa Dash on Canada Boulevard in front of the Liver Buildings. It finishes in front of the Town Hall at Castle Street. Organisers of the Liverpool Santa Dash had said that they may drop the charity run due to rising council fees, with the event co-ordinators BTR Liverpool paying Liverpool City Council more than £17,000 to stage this year's race. The Medicash Santa Dash Liverpool 2015 takes place on Sunday, 6 December – and organisers BTR Liverpool are hoping to attract 10,000 Santas. Liverpool earned the World Santa Challenge title last year when 8,846 Santas took part – making it the world’s biggest festive fun run. Las Vegas had held the title since 2011. Sue Weir, Chief Executive of Medicash, commented: “We are delighted to be supporting the world’s largest festive fun run and really hope the race succeeds in its aim of attracting over 10,000 Santas. It’s a great opportunity to get into the festive spirit early and encourage healthy activity in the city. “Medicash aims to improve health and wellbeing and this event encourages Liverpool City Region to take a proactive approach to fitness while having fun. It’s a great opportunity for us to get active, have fun and raise money for charity.” Title sponsors Medicash are one of the oldest and most established healthcare cash plan providers in the UK with over 180,000 corporate and individual policy holders. Medicash, formerly known as The Penny in the Pound Fund, has been a core part of the city since it was first established in 1871. The route takes Santas through the city centre, before they enjoy a festive grandstand finish outside Liverpool Town Hall. The event is open to all and attracts individuals; families; charity runners; and corporate The Medicash Santa Dash Liverpool is organised by BTR Liverpool, the leading independent organisation for creating, managing and delivering headline race events in Liverpool City Region. Its growing portfolio includes the Vitality Liverpool Half Marathon, Tour of Merseyside, Tunnel 10K and award-winning Wirral Half Marathon/10K. The official charity partners are Radio City’s Cash For Kids; Claire House Children’s Hospice; Everton in the Community; Jospice; and Roy Castle Lung Cancer Foundation – who are the five BTR Footsteps Fundraisers charities.
